Public Information Statement
National Weather Service Midland/Odessa TX
416 PM CDT Tue Jun 11 2024 /316 PM MDT Tue Jun 11 2024/

.Overview...On June 11th, the National Weather Service
investigated tornado reports from June 10th in rural Gaines
and Dawson Counties. Using photos, videos, and radar data,
approximate damage tracks were created.

.East of Loop Tornado...

Rating:                 EF-Unknown
Estimated Peak Wind:    Unknown
Path Length /statute/:  1.16 Miles
Path Width /maximum/:   Unknown
Fatalities:             0
Injuries:               0

Start Date:             June_10_2024
Start Time:             7:22 PM CDT
Start Location:         4 E Loop
Start Lat/Lon:          32.93/-102.36

End Date:               June_10_2024
End Time:               7:25 PM CDT
End Location:           5 E Loop
End Lat/Lon:            32.91/-102.35

Multiple observers reported a brief cone tornado to the northeast of
Loop. The tornado only lasted two to three minutes over open fields.
The tornado likely dissipated near US Highway 83. No damage was
reported and this tornado is rated EF-Unknown. Path is estimated from
reports and radar data.

.West of Lamesa Tornado...

Rating:                 EF-Unknown
Estimated Peak Wind:    Unknown
Path Length /statute/:  0.51 Miles
Path Width /maximum/:   Unknown
Fatalities:             0
Injuries:               0

Start Date:             June_10_2024
Start Time:             8:23 PM CDT
Start Location:         8 W Lamesa
Start Lat/Lon:          32.73/-102.10

End Date:               June_10_2024
End Time:               8:24 PM CDT
End Location:           8 W Lamesa
End Lat/Lon:            32.73/-102.09

A video shared to broadcast media showed a brief rope tornado over an
open field. The tornado did not cause any damage and is rated EF-Unknown.
The path is estimated from this report and radar data.
